Block 2645936

0xcaaa030d996ac822a9b5fb1503e7e189863e612525b33186cff47da8361f0205
Transactions0
Height2645936
Confirmations18901553
TimestampThu, 17 Nov 2016 19:33:51 UTC
Size (bytes)523
Version
Merkle Root
Nonce0x4f1896c3804571d0
Bits
Difficulty0x5f6ab311175